废话就不多说了,开始。。。
应用myeclipse启动两个SSH2的部署在tomcat6下的项目
报出java.lang.OutOfMemoryError: PermGen space
解决办法:
在myeclipse中加大jvm内存方法:
Window->Preferences->Myeclipse->Services->Tomcat->Tomcat 6.x->JDK,在Optional Java VM arguments:下边的输入框里输入:
-Xms128m -Xmx512m -XX:PermSize=128m -XX:MaxPermSize=128m
上边的数值看起来不大,但是我的项目运行很稳定了,可以先不要急着改掉上边的数值,先用上边的数值运行试试,如果还是溢出的话再恰当调整
下边是直接调整jdk/jre的jvm的方法
Window->Preferences->Java->Installed JREs,在右侧双击当前应用的jdk/jre,在Default VM Arguments中输入
-Xms128m -Xmx512m
文章结束给大家分享下程序员的一些笑话语录:
苹果与谷歌之争就是封闭收费与自由免费思想之争。(别急着把google来膜拜哦?那可是一家公司,以赚钱为目标的公司!当年我Party就是这样把广大劳动人民吸引过来的。今天的结果你们都看到了。)
---------------------------------
原创文章 By
内存溢出和数值
---------------------------------